How they compare

Western Africa currently reports 0.4502 kt against 0.0246 kt in Côte d'Ivoire, a difference of 0.4256 kt.

That makes Western Africa's figure about 18.3 times Côte d'Ivoire's.

Across all 34 years both countries report, Western Africa has been ahead every year.

Côte d'Ivoire ranks 31st and Western Africa ranks 30th of 31 countries.

Western Africa has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
